Abstract

This study analyzes impoliteness strategies used by netizens in the column comments on Blanco’s Instagram, which posted about his girlfriend, Selena Gomez. The data were collected from one post with 50 English comments in response to Benny Blanco’s Instagram post on July 22, 2024. Qualitative descriptive research was used for data analysis. Culpeper’s impoliteness theory is used to analyze the data. The research results indicate that the bald on record is the dominant types of impoliteness that netizen used to respond Benny Blanco’s post with 24 data (48%), followed by positive impoliteness with 16 data (32%), negative impoliteness with 6 data (12%), and sarcasm with 4 data (8%). Additionally, the most dominant functions of impoliteness that netizens used are affective impoliteness with 29 data (58%), coercive impoliteness with 11 data (22%), and entertaining impoliteness with 10 data (20%). These results indicate that impoliteness in social media does not only indicate rudeness but also as a way to attack someone. In addition, netizens use impoliteness in Instagram to express disagreement with Benny and Selena’s relationship.
